Description

Instead of heading straight into the main Grand Vallon route, traverse to the left along the ridge before descending a short pitch to a well-defined saddle.

Stay high and cross the saddle to access a treasure-trove of fun "mini-golf" terrain.

A variety of short chutes and cliffs drop down to your right back into the main Grand Vallon bowl.

The best approach is to tick one off and then scope the next on your traverse back to the Pyramides chair for the next lap.

The further round you traverse, the more vertical you unlock, until eventually you reach the end of the ridge with slopes leading directly back to the bottom of the Pyramides chair.

With all of these variants, be sure there aren't skiers skiing or traversing below you.

If you trigger an avalanche on any of these steepish slopes and there is a group below you, you're likely to ruin their day!
